Description

4-[3,6-Bis(Diethylamino)-9H-Xanthen-9-Yl]Benzene-1,3-Disulphonic Acid is a high-purity xanthene dye intermediate, valued for its role in synthesizing advanced fluorescent markers and colorants. This compound is critical for ensuring the performance and stability of dyes used in demanding analytical and industrial applications. It is primarily required by manufacturers in the biotechnology, diagnostic, and specialty chemical sectors for producing sensitive detection reagents and high-value pigments.

Application

  • Fluorescent Dye Synthesis: A key precursor for manufacturing rhodamine and other xanthene-based fluorescent dyes used in bio-labeling and flow cytometry.
  • Diagnostic Reagents: Used in the production of reagents for clinical diagnostics, histology, and immunoassays.
  • Laser Dyes: Serves as a building block for dyes utilized in tunable dye lasers and optical research.
  • Industrial Colorants: Intermediate for creating high-performance pigments and colorants for inks, coatings, and plastics.
  • Research & Development: Employed in chemical research for developing new photostable fluorescent probes and sensors.
  • Photographic Sensitizers: Used in the formulation of specialized photographic and imaging chemicals.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ept sealed to minimize exposure to atmospheric humidity.
